Title says it all really,just an update from an earlier review,in which I unjustly criticised this little bike.Owned from new,and had it for 7 years now.It was carelessly assembled by a factory worker who clearly didn't give a sh*t,causing 2 wiring shorts and breakdowns about a year after I bought it,but after getting the wiring loom properly routed it hasn't gone wrong. I thought the piston rings were wearing recently,until I replaced the air filter (I know,should have done it much sooner)and cleaned out the breather.Now pulling much better,and still delivering about 120 mpg. I put off doing the valve clearances for a long time because I didn't want to break into all the plastic covering,but it's actually very easy to do.The rear brake linkage is very prone to rusting and seizing,but again,easy to clean up and lube. You can quite easily do all your own servicing on this bike,even without much mechanical knowledge,just keep on top of the oil changes and the general condition of the chain ( also very easy to replace)
Tip- if you change the oil whenever you service the chain you will get much longer life out of the engine. I'm going to keep mine for another 7 years and much more mileage.
